Dorothy Winfrey Phelps, who was just eleven days shy of her 96th birthday, went to be with the Lord on Wednesday, October 16, 2024, surrounded by her family.

Dorothy was born in Avon, Illinois on October 27, 1928, to Kenneth N. and Mary Margaret Curtis.  Dorothy lived a life devoted to faith and family.  She worked at Security Savings Bank in Monmouth, Illinois for 25 years and volunteered extensively throughout her community.

Dorothy is survived by her sister, Millie Sorrells; five children: Dave (Syd), Debbie, Patty (Glenn), Carol (Mick) and Gary (Sue); 13 grandchildren, 16 great grandchildren and a host of extended family.  Dorothy was preceded in death by her husband of 26 years, James F. Phelps, her parents, her brother, Delbert Curtis and grandson Jon M. Ellison.
